PEOPLE v. CHANDLER

Docket Nos. 144968, 151287.

211 Mich. App. 604 (1995)

536 N.W.2d 799

PEOPLE v. CHANDLER

Michigan Court of Appeals.

Decided June 23, 1995, at 9:25 A.M.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Frank J. Kelley, Attorney General, Thomas L. Casey, Solicitor General, Brian L. Mackie, Prosecuting Attorney, and David A. King, Senior Assistant Prosecuting Attorney, for the people.

State Appellate Defender (by Richard B. Ginsberg), for the defendant on appeal.

Before: CORRIGAN, P.J. and MARKEY and J.R. ERNST, JJ.


CORRIGAN, P.J.

In these consolidated cases, defendant Gregory Chandler appeals as of right in Docket No. 144968 his conviction by jury of first-degree criminal sexual conduct, MCL 750.520b(1) (e); MSA 28.788(2)(1)(e), and plea-based conviction of being an habitual offender, fourth offense, MCL 769.12; MSA 28.1084, and in Docket No. 151287 his conviction by another jury of assault with intent to commit criminal sexual...
